Transaction 51399e78b96fa2f321d97a5c749f979b1d77ae2b78f454a8d65096d46123d395
1 Input
2 Outputs
- 51399e78b96fa2f321d97a5c749f979b1d77ae2b78f454a8d65096d46123d395:0
- 51399e78b96fa2f321d97a5c749f979b1d77ae2b78f454a8d65096d46123d395:1
value 25000000
address 1Efjbf37wmXwy2ZFWUTgjTUb6XrJj1uv9p
value 134358
address 1CWLRHDJ2PW5m9rs7k1BbkJFK9MxfYaZTg